Output 626f6144a68f74532a703035584c9d56fef0db207e598fc46dd70d7f49d57e54: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88aa70e2cf7cba585ac9d754fdbeefbf6a33486b OP_EQUAL
address
3E9e15VXi2CFBizC51wbZJLbxh3PcMDCQS
transaction
626f6144a68f74532a703035584c9d56fef0db207e598fc46dd70d7f49d57e54
confirmations
60294
spent
true